    The group's reportedly have ties to the Sea Change Foundation based in San Francisco

    House Energy and Commerce Committee Republicans are calling on certain environmental groups to disclose their ties to a non-governmental organization which is, according to the committee, reportedly used by
    Russian President Vladimir Putin to make an impact on American energy production.

    Three environmental groups – the League of Conservation Voters (LCV), the Natural Resources Defense Council (NRDC), and the Sierra Club – reportedly have ties to the San Francisco-based NGO environmental organization called the Sea Change Foundation, according to Republicans on the committee.

    In a letter sent to each of the three groups, Republicans inquired about
    the funding the groups have received from Sea Change since 2006 and called for disclosure of whether the groups "are aware of concerns that Sea
    Change may be a conduit for Russian funding."

    "Provided the public reporting of Putin's dark money influence in Europe
    and the concerns surrounding similar efforts in the United States, we
    write today to explore your connections with Sea Change," the Republicans stated in the letter. "Any action by President Putin, the Russian
    government, or Putin's allies to undermine American energy security must
    be addressed."

    In addition, the Republicans asked the groups if they have received funds
    or took a particular action after a request "from the Russian government
    or anyone connected with the Russian government."

    All three of the groups, according to Republicans on the committee, were identified as top recipients of Sea Change grants since 2006. The letter
    was signed by more than 20 Congressional Republicans, including Energy and Commerce Committee Republican leader Rep. Cathy McMorris Rodgers, Wash.,
    and ranking member Rep. Fred Upton, R-Mich.

    "If the League of Conservation Voters, the Natural Resources Defense
    Council, and the Sierra Club have nothing to hide, then we look forward to seeing the evidence by March 25," a spokesperson for Energy and Commerce Republicans told Fox News.
